mysql-python
(也称为 MySQLdb
)是一个用于 Python 语言的 MySQL 数据库驱动程序。它允许 Python 程序与 MySQL 数据库进行交互,执行 SQL 查询和操作。
mysql-python
是一个成熟的库,已经存在多年,具有较高的稳定性和可靠性。mysql-python
在各种 Python 项目和环境中都有广泛的应用和支持。mysql-python
是一个基于 C 语言扩展的 Python 库,提供了对 MySQL 数据库的底层访问。
mysql-python
适用于需要与 MySQL 数据库进行交互的 Python 应用程序,包括但不限于:
mysql-python
需要依赖 MySQL 的 C API 库,如果系统中没有安装相应的库,安装会失败。mysql-python
可能与特定版本的 Python 或 MySQL 不兼容。mysql-python
之前,确保系统已经安装了 MySQL 的 C API 库。例如,在 Ubuntu 上可以运行以下命令:mysql-python
之前,确保系统已经安装了 MySQL 的 C API 库。例如,在 Ubuntu 上可以运行以下命令:mysql-python
,以避免与其他 Python 环境的冲突。mysql-python
,以避免与其他 Python 环境的冲突。mysql-python
的版本与你的 Python 和 MySQL 版本兼容。可以在 mysql-python
的官方文档或 PyPI 页面上查找兼容性信息。sudo
命令进行安装:sudo
命令进行安装:以下是一个简单的示例代码,展示如何使用 mysql-python
连接到 MySQL 数据库并执行查询:
import MySQLdb
# 连接到数据库
conn = MySQLdb.connect(host="localhost", user="your_username", passwd="your_password", db="your_database")
# 创建游标对象
cursor = conn.cursor()
# 执行查询
cursor.execute("SELECT * FROM your_table")
# 获取结果
results = cursor.fetchall()
# 打印结果
for row in results:
print(row)
# 关闭游标和连接
cursor.close()
conn.close()
通过以上步骤和示例代码,你应该能够成功安装并使用 mysql-python
进行 MySQL 数据库的交互。
领取专属 10元无门槛券
手把手带您无忧上云